Join the Mid Klamath Watershed Council (MKWC) on August 22, 2024 at the Humboldt Bay Social Club in Samoa for a Pints for Nonprofits fundraiser. The family-friendly event begins at 5 pm and runs until 8 pm. One dollar ($1) from every pint sold will be donated to MKWC. Additionally, this event will have music by Ryan Roberts of Absynth Quartet, a dessert auction and food available for sale from the Manzanilla Kitchen food truck.
Located in the northeastern Humboldt County hamlet of Orleans (with a branch in the Siskiyou County town of Happy Camp), MKWC is a restoration organization, focusing on projects in the Klamath River watershed that directly benefit our anadromous fisheries and forest resources. The organization utilizes grant funding combined with community and stakeholder volunteers to collaboratively plan and implement ecosystem restoration, promote community vitality, and involve people in land stewardship. Our programs include Fire and Forestry, Fisheries, Community and Stewardship, and Plants. For more on MKWC and the work we do, visit www.mkwc.org.
